泰坦之旅不朽王座存档修改全攻略与角色属性自定义指南

频道:详细攻略 日期: 浏览:42

泰坦之旅:不朽王座作为一款经典的ARPG游戏,其深度玩法与角色构建系统吸引了大量硬核玩家。将系统性地解析游戏存档的修改逻辑与角色属性自定义技巧,为玩家提供安全、高效的进阶操作指南。

泰坦之旅不朽王座存档修改全攻略与角色属性自定义指南

存档文件结构与工具准备

游戏存档文件通常位于以下路径:

`C:\\Users\\[用户名]\\Documents\\My Games\\Titan Quest

  • Immortal Throne\\SaveData\\Main`
  • 存档主体文件为`player.chr`,包含角色属性、物品栏、任务进度等数据。推荐使用以下工具进行修改:

    1. TQDefiler:开源存档编辑器,支持直接修改属性点、技能等级与装备词条。

    2. Hex Editor Neo:十六进制编辑器,需配合存档结构文档进行高级修改。

    3. 第三方存档修改器(如TQ Vault)可批量管理物品,但需注意版本兼容性。

    角色属性修改核心逻辑

    1. 基础属性修改

    使用TQDefiler打开`player.chr`后,定位至`Character Stats`模块:

  • 力量/敏捷/智力/生命/法力:直接输入目标数值,建议不超过32767(16位有符号整数上限)。
  • 技能点重置:将`AttributePoints`与`SkillPoints`字段数值归零可重置未分配点数。
  • *示例代码片段:*

    ```xml

    ```

    2. 技能等级与专精控制

    在`Mastery Levels`节点中,修改`level`参数可调整专精等级(最高40级)。需同步调整`MasteryPointsSpent`字段以匹配实际投入点数,否则可能导致技能树异常。

    3. 装备属性自定义

    通过十六进制编辑器定位装备数据块(通常以`0A 00 00 00`开头):

  • 词条追加:复制其他装备的十六进制代码段插入目标位置,需保持数据结构对齐。
  • 属性强化:修改`+X% 元素伤害`或`+X 全抗性`等字段的数值偏移量,需参考游戏内词条ID表。
  • 进阶自定义技巧

    1. 突破等级上限

    将`player.chr`中的`Level`字段修改为85以上可实现伪·满级,但需同步调整经验值字段`Experience`为`7FFFFFFF`(十进制)以避免系统重置。

    2. 隐藏属性解锁

    部分未实装属性(如"投射物穿透+100%")可通过添加以下代码激活:

    ```xml

    ```

    此类操作需依赖社区发布的扩展属性库文件。

    3. 自定义Build实例

    *双持法师实现方案:*

  • 修改角色主手与副手槽位标志位,解除武器类型限制。
  • 为法杖添加近战伤害加成词条,同步提升`Cast Speed`与`Attack Speed`属性。
  • 在`Skills`节点中强制关联远程与近战技能树(需修改技能触发逻辑)。
  • 风险规避与兼容性处理

    1. 存档备份原则

    修改前务必复制原始存档至独立目录。建议使用版本管理工具(如Git)追踪每次修改记录。

    2. 数值溢出防护

    当属性值超过32767时,部分字段会触发整数反转(如生命值显示为负数)。可通过拆分属性至不同词条规避此问题。

    3. 联机模式限制

    修改后的存档在多人联机时可能触发反作弊检测。建议在离线模式下测试自定义Build,并删除非常规词条后再进行联机。

    存档修改为玩家提供了突破游戏框架的可能性,但需建立在理解底层数据结构的基础上。建议优先通过合法游戏机制体验核心内容,将属性自定义作为二周目或特殊挑战的补充手段。对于高级开发者,可进一步研究Lua脚本注入或MOD工具实现更深层次的功能扩展。

    内容灵感来自(EXIQU游戏网)